Ingredients for Easy Corn Casserole Recipe:
To create this delightful Easy Corn Casserole, gather the following ingredients:
– 1 box of Jiffy Corn Muffin mix (8 ounces, dry mix only)
– 15 ounces of whole kernel corn (drained)
– 15 ounces of creamed corn (not drained)
– 1 cup of sour cream
– 1/2 cup of melted butter

Step-by-Step Guide on How to Prepare Easy Corn Casserole Recipe:
Creating an easy corn casserole is a breeze and perfect for any occasion. Begin by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a large mixing bowl, combine 1 box of Jiffy Corn Muffin mix (8 ounces), the drained 15 ounces of whole kernel corn, and the 15 ounces of creamed corn (don’t drain!). Next, stir in 1 cup of sour cream and half a cup of melted butter. Make sure all ingredients are well mixed until uniform.
Grease a 9×13-inch baking dish with cooking spray or additional melted butter. Pour the corn mixture into the dish and spread it evenly. Bake for approximately 45 minutes, or until the top turns golden brown and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Allow it to cool for a few minutes before serving. Storage tips for Easy Corn Casserole Recipe:
To ensure your Easy Corn Casserole Recipe stays fresh and delicious, proper storage is key. First, allow the casserole to cool completely before storing it. Place leftovers in an airtight container or cover the dish tightly with aluminum foil. This helps prevent moisture loss and maintains flavor.
For best results, store the casserole in the refrigerator for up to three days. You can also freeze portions for later use. To do this, cut the casserole into individual servings and wrap each portion in plastic wrap. Then, place the wrapped servings in a freezer-safe bag. They can be stored in the freezer for up to three months. When ready to enjoy, thaw overnight in the refrigerator and reheat in the oven or microwave.

Easy Corn Casserole Recipe
- Total Time: 55 minutes
- Yield: 10–12 servings 1x
- Diet: Vegetarian
Description
This Easy Corn Casserole Recipe combines corn muffin mix, whole kernel corn, and creamed corn for a deliciously moist and savory dish that is perfect for any gathering.
Ingredients
- 1 box of Jiffy Corn Muffin mix (8 ounces
- dry mix only)
- 15 ounces whole kernel corn (drained)
- 15 ounces creamed corn (not drained)
- 1 cup sour cream
- 1/2 cup melted butter
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a large mixing bowl, combine the Jiffy Corn Muffin mix, whole kernel corn, creamed corn, sour cream, and melted butter.
- Mix until well combined.
- Pour the mixture into a greased 9×13 inch baking dish.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 30-35 minutes or until golden brown.
- Let it cool for a few minutes before serving.
Notes
For a richer flavor, you can add shredded cheese or chives to the mixture before baking.
